2026 MLB Draft: Mariners' Selections and Final Mock Projections Shape First‑Round Outlook

The Seattle Mariners will make 20 selections in the 2026 MLB Draft, opening with the No. 24 overall pick on July 11 in Philadelphia. With a total bonus pool of just over $8.2 million and a slot value of about $3.8 million for their first pick, the club has flexibility to allocate funds across the class and will need to find value later in the first round.

Ahead of the draft, ESPN analyst Kiley McDaniel released a final mock draft for the top 13 picks. The mock retains the same top three selections as earlier, projecting UCLA shortstop Roch Cholowsky to the Chicago White Sox, followed by shortstops Grady Emerson (Rays) and Vahn Lackey (Twins). The mock also compares these projections with Baseball‑Reference’s latest draft outlook.
